I love this place because of the chill environment, the huge selection of fish and the kindness of the staff. There’s a small selection of birds (Cockatiel $475), lizards and small rodents (hamsters, mice, etc.) but I didn’t get any photos, sorry! I wasn’t inclined to photograph until we got to the impressive collection of fish. There’s a really large selection of marine creatures from bettas to tetras to frogs and lobsters! There are fish that glow (or fluoresce if we’re being technical) and fish as big as my hand! There was a blue lobster, a red lobster and a white one (my son’s personal favorite). Also, the staff seems friendly and knowledgeable about their creatures. I got to hear one staff member talking to a little girl about what fish could go in her ten gallon tank and which could not. Overall, it was once again pleasant to visit the pet store and we will be back again! Hope the photos do it justice!

When I first came to this store and purchased my Red Severum I was very impressed he’s healthy and well tempered. However I recently returned to the store the previous weekend and purchased 10 Cardinal Tetras at $4.99 per fish. I kinda laughed off the sales person who told me not to panic if the tetras “play dead” in the bag on the way home thinking either he was inexperienced or that this was some sort of fish keeping rumor as I had never heard about it before anyway I ignored him and brought them home to be drip acclimated. Since the purchase 6 out of the 10 tetras have passed and when I called the store to complain and inform them of their tetras being sick I was essentially told “Oh that sucks, they’re very fragile fish” no apology no attempts to make it better. Tetras as far as I’ve known in all my experience in fish keeping are incredibly hardy fish. I’ve checked my water parameters everything is in appropriate ranges for these fish the other occupants of the tank are leaving them alone and not dying randomly so what am I left to think. I will not be returning here again and I would advise anyone else against shopping for aquatics there as well. 2 stars only because of my Red Severum Teri doing so well
